3. SEVENTEEN

SEVENTEEN is a 13-member boy group known for its self-produced music, intricate choreography, and strong bond with fans known as “Carats.” The group is divided into three units – Vocal Team, Hip-Hop Team, and Performance Team – each showcasing their unique talents. SEVENTEEN’s members include S.Coups, Jeonghan, Joshua, Jun, Hoshi, Wonwoo, Woozi, DK, Mingyu, The8, Seungkwan, Vernon, and Dino.

4. NCT (Neo Culture Technology)

NCT is a unique K-pop boy group concept developed by SM Entertainment, characterized by its rotational lineup and multiple sub-units catering to different markets and languages. The group’s members are constantly evolving, with new additions and rotations across various sub-units. NCT currently has 23 members spread across units such as NCT 127, NCT Dream, and WayV.

5. Super Junior

Super Junior is one of the pioneering K-pop boy groups, known for their longevity in the industry and diverse range of talents. Originally debuting with 13 members, the group has undergone lineup changes over the years and currently consists of nine active members: Leeteuk, Heechul, Yesung, Shindong, Eunhyuk, Donghae, Siwon, Ryeowook, and Kyuhyun.

6. TREASURE

TREASURE is a rookie boy group under YG Entertainment, known for their energetic performances and youthful charisma. The group debuted in 2020 with 12 members through the survival reality show “YG Treasure Box.” TREASURE’s members include Hyunsuk, Jihoon, Yoshi, Junkyu, Mashiho, Jaehyuk, Asahi, Yedam, Doyoung, Haruto, Jeongwoo, and Junghwan.

7. Golden Child

Golden Child is a boy group under Woollim Entertainment, known for their bright and youthful image, as well as their synchronized choreography. The group debuted in 2017 with 11 members and has since gained popularity for its catchy music and engaging performances. Golden Child’s members include Daeyeol, Y, Jangjun, TAG, Seungmin, Jaehyun, Jibeom, Donghyun, Joochan, Bomin, and former member Sungyoon.
